Medical Expense Benefits definition

Medical Expense Benefits means those benefits payable under the Rules and Regulations of the Plan for specified expenses incurred in the treatment of a bodily injury or sickness.

More Definitions of Medical Expense Benefits

Medical Expense Benefits means an amount not exceeding $250,000 per person per accident for reasonable expenses incurred for medical, surgical, and dental treatment, professional nursing, hospital and rehabilitation services, x-ray and other diagnostic services, prosthetic devices, ambulance services
Medical Expense Benefits means an amount not exceeding $250,000 per person per accident for reasonable expenses incurred for medical, surgical and dental treatment, professional nursing, hospital and rehabilitation services, x-ray and other diagnostic services, prosthetic devices, ambulance services, medication and other reasonable and necessary expenses incurred for treatment prescribed by persons licensed to practice medicine, surgery, psychology or chiropractic, or for any non-medical remedial treatment rendered in accordance with a recognized re- ligious method of healing; however, it does not include expenses in excess of those for a semiprivate room, unless more intensive care is medically required.
